What companies run services between Guangzhou South, China and Hainan, China?

You can take a subway from Guangzhou South to Bihu Garden via Gongyuanqian, Guangzhou, Xuwen Station, Haikou Xiuying Port Bus Terminal, and Maritime Bureau in around 11h 58m. Alternatively, China Railways Z-Class operates a train from Guangzhou Train Station to Haikou 3 times a day. Tickets cost ¥80–158 and the journey takes 11h 22m. China Railways K-Class also services this route once daily.
